'The Flash' TV Series Release Date, News: DC Superhero Show Premieres October 7 [TRAILER VIDEO]
From the creators of 'Arrow' comes another superhero-based TV series entitled 'The Flash'. Inspired by the fictional comics, The Flash is Barry Allen's alter ego, a scientist who takes on a journey of being a superhero with an incredible speed.
Played by Grant Gustin, The Flash serves as the protector of Central City as he battles with forces of evil. In the trailer video shown by the network, The Flash comes face to face with Weather Wizard, whose alter ego is Clyde Mardon played by Chad Rook on the show.
"[The Flash] had a sense of humor, and a sense of awe of the things that were happening to him, and around him. You put that all together, and you just get a brighter show. And we wanted to contrast it from 'Arrow' -- and we were all big Donner 'Superman' fans. I've always felt that was the most iconic version of the bright superhero world," executive producer Greg Berlanti said.
This super villain harbors power from natural elements and turns them into devastating weapons of destruction against humans. 'The Flash' also meets 'Arrow' in the season premiere telling him that his powers are actually a gift to mankind.
'The Flash' TV Series premieres on October 7 back to back with 'Arrow' on October 8 on The CW.
